Shield AI Raises $2B at $12.7B Valuation [2026]
Shield AI has raised $2 billion in a Series G funding round, increasing its valuation to $12.7 billion. The funds will support the acquisition of Aechelon Technology and the development of the Hivemind autonomous piloting platform.
Russia's Rubicon drone units reshape Ukraine warfare
Russia's Rubicon drone units have transformed drone warfare in Ukraine by standardizing operations and enhancing tactical innovation. These units have improved artillery accuracy and forced tactical changes, such as infantry moving on foot due to drone saturation.
Jamming-resistant drone interceptor "Yolka" combined with "Pantsirs" for the first time
The 'Yolka' jamming-resistant drone interceptor has been integrated with the 'Pantsir' anti-aircraft missile systems to enhance counter-UAS operations during reloading periods. 'Yolka' uses kinetic strikes, is undetectable by electronic warfare, and operates at speeds up to 230 km/h.
Sweden unveils 957-mln-USD anti-drone air defense system-Xinhua
Sweden has announced a $957 million investment in the Gute II anti-drone air defense system, featuring mobile and modular artillery-based platforms. The system will be deployed to protect military units and critical infrastructure by 2027-2028.

Project Manager Maneuver Ammunition Systems Works To Increase Lethality Of Existing Weapon Systems | Article | The United States Army
The U.S. Army is addressing the growing threat of inexpensive, commercially available UAS by enhancing existing weapon systems like the Bradley Infantry Fighting Vehicle. The evolving UAS threat requires a shift from traditional electronic warfare to diverse, cost-effective kinetic solutions.

UK deploys Rapid Sentry anti-drone system to Kuwait to fend off attacks, air force says | Euronews
The UK has deployed its Rapid Sentry anti-drone system to Kuwait in response to Iranian drone attacks targeting Gulf countries. This deployment aims to protect Kuwaiti and British interests while avoiding further escalation in the region.

Inside the spring offensive giving Ukraine fresh cause for optimism
Ukraine's 82nd Air Assault Brigade has effectively countered Russian advances using advanced drone warfare and improved infiltration tactics. The brigade's use of AI-assisted drones and enhanced artillery capabilities has contributed to significant Russian casualties and territorial gains for Ukraine.
